Shock Aero 3D is a 3D architecture and interior design software for Windows. It allows users to create realistic 3D models and visualizations with a focus on ease of use and powerful rendering capabilities.
Winflip is a lightweight open source alternative to Microsoft PowerPoint for Windows. It allows users to create presentations with slides, text, images, shapes, charts, animations and more.
